wang_zf
驱动牛犊
驱动牛犊
  • 注册日期2001-04-30
  • 最后登录2003-12-09
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:2401回复:1

PCI网卡初始化过程

楼主#
更多 发布于:2001-05-28 16:48
在做MiniprotDriver时,何时检测的硬件卡?又是在何时把信息写入注册表供MiniprotInitialize时读取?是否在硬件加电时由BIOS检测硬件卡同时写入注册表。
我在Microsoft 的DDK的NE2000中没有发现有检测硬件卡的代码,就直接读取注册表,但是在《WinNT Device Driver Development》一书中的PCI驱动程序sample中发现有根据BUS Number和Device number检测硬件卡的代码。为什么?

最新喜欢:

wingmanwingma...
lxf
lxf
驱动小牛
驱动小牛
  • 注册日期2001-03-26
  • 最后登录2013-05-04
  • 粉丝4
  • 关注0
  • 积分76分
  • 威望30点
  • 贡献值0点
  • 好评度7点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2001-05-28 17:09
在 WIN2K/98 中,是由PNP发现硬件并将其对应信息写入注册表,网卡初始化时再读这些信息,再加上自身信息,并将其加入注册表。
BIOS初始化是不会写注册表的。
至于NT,应该是因为她不支持PNP.

别着急,慢慢来!
游客

返回顶部